A great ship is only half the story. The true heart of the journey is the itinerary, and our 7-night roundtrip from Seattle was a masterclass in Alaskan immersion. Each day brought a new landscape, a new adventure, and a deeper connection to this incredible land.
The journey begins and ends with scenic cruising through the Inside Passage, a tranquil waterway shielded from the open ocean. This is where the magic starts. The ship glides through narrow channels, flanked by emerald-green forests and snow-capped peaks. The highlight was our day navigating the dramatic Tracy Arm Fjord, a 30-mile-long waterway culminating in the twin Sawyer Glaciers. The silence of the fjord, broken only by the cries of gulls and the distant rumble of moving ice, is profoundly peaceful.
Alaska’s capital city is uniquely accessible only by air or sea. The star attraction here is the magnificent Mendenhall Glacier, a 13-mile-long river of ice that is both awe-inspiring and humbling. We opted for a shore excursion that combined a visit to the glacier with a whale-watching tour. Within an hour, we were surrounded by a pod of bubble-net feeding humpback whales—a breathtaking display of power and grace. Walking into Skagway is like stepping onto a movie set for a Klondike Gold Rush film. The perfectly preserved boardwalks and false-front buildings transport you back to 1898. The must-do excursion here is the White Pass & Yukon Route Railroad. This narrow-gauge railway, a marvel of vintage engineering, climbs nearly 3,000 feet in just 20 miles, offering jaw-dropping views of mountains, gorges, and waterfalls. It’s a journey through history and scenery that is simply unforgettable.
Our final Alaskan port was Ketchikan, a vibrant town clinging to the shores of the Tongass Narrows. Famous for its salmon, its rich Native heritage, and the historic Creek Street (a former red-light district built on stilts over the water), Ketchikan is a delight to explore. We spent our day visiting the Totem Heritage Center and Potlatch Park, home to the world's largest collection of standing totem poles. The artistry and storytelling carved into these massive cedar logs offer a powerful glimpse into the Tlingit, Haida, and Tsimshian cultures.

The Alaska cruise season runs from late April to September. June, July, and August offer the warmest weather and longest daylight hours. May and September are considered "shoulder seasons" and often provide better pricing, fewer crowds, and a chance to see the northern lights late in the season.
Layers are key! The weather can change quickly. Pack waterproof and windproof jackets, comfortable walking shoes, sweaters or fleeces, and a mix of pants and shirts. Don't forget binoculars for wildlife viewing, a camera, sunscreen, and insect repellent. Most evenings on the ship are smart casual, but it's nice to have a slightly dressier option for specialty dining.

Shore excursions are not typically included in the base cruise fare. This allows you the flexibility to choose the activities that most interest you. You can book them through the cruise line or with independent operators. We highly recommend booking in advance as popular tours sell out quickly.
